Analy sisand maintenance of electrical faults insinovel SL1500 windturbine pitch system
Pitch control,with advantages of good starting performance,simple braking,and high power generation efficiency,is widely used in wind turbines.However,practical applications encounter issues such as high failure rates and diagnostic challenges.The electrical faults in the pitch systemof Sinovel SL1500 wind turbinearecategorized and analyzed,and the causesare investigated from a structural and theoretical perspective to understand the occurrence mechanism of these faults.Diagnostic methods for electrical faults in the pitch system are proposed to quickly locate problems.Weak points in the turbine system are identified,and maintenance and technical improvements are recommended to reduce the occurrence of faults.The aim is to provide valuable references for future pitch system electrical fault inspection,technical upgrades,and enhance equipment utilization.
